The C9 Resin Market is growing steadily, supported by its diverse applications in paints, coatings, adhesives, and rubber processing. More than 55% of demand comes from coatings and printing inks, where it improves gloss retention, drying efficiency, and overall finish quality.
Expanding Use in Adhesives and Sealants
In adhesives and sealants, nearly 46% of usage is recorded across construction, packaging, and automotive industries. C9 resins enhance bonding strength, tack performance, and durability, making them integral to reliable adhesion systems.
Growing Role in Rubber and Tire Manufacturing
The rubber and tire industry accounts for about 41% of consumption, where these resins improve durability, mechanical strength, and processability. Their compatibility with elastomers ensures consistent results in heavy-duty applications.
Technological Advancements in Resin Production
Advances in hydrogenated resins and blending innovations represent approximately 37% of new developments, delivering improvements in stability, odor reduction, and resistance to discoloration. These qualities have broadened adoption in premium performance applications.

C9 Resin Market, Segmentation by Grade
The Grade segmentation underscores how polymer architecture and co-monomer selection shape performance traits such as tackification efficiency, glass transition, color, and compatibility with other hydrocarbons or polar polymers. Producers compete on softening point distribution, stability, and filtration clarity, while investing in feedstock flexibility and process control. This enables differentiated positioning across adhesives, coatings, and elastomer modification use cases.
HomopolymerHomopolymer C9 resins provide consistent tack, moderate color, and reliable compatibility with non-polar systems, making them workhorses in pressure-sensitive and hot-melt adhesives. Suppliers emphasize batch-to-batch uniformity and predictable rheology to streamline converter operations. These grades often anchor cost-effective portfolios where robustness outweighs the need for specialized attributes.
CopolymerCopolymer grades introduce tailored polarity and compatibility windows that improve adhesion to varied substrates and enhance blend stability. They enable formulators to fine-tune viscosity and softening points for performance-critical applications. Vendors highlight versatility in adhesives and coatings, supported by technical service that shortens qualification cycles with OEMs.
TerpolymerTerpolymer grades deliver even finer control over tack, cohesion, and flexibility, supporting demanding environments and multi-substrate assemblies. These resins can bridge polarity gaps, enhancing compatibility with diverse polymers and boosting long-term aging performance. Producers leverage application development and pilot-scale trials to unlock premium niches requiring advanced balance of properties.
C9 Resin Market, Segmentation by End-Use Industry
The End-Use Industry view maps demand drivers to downstream growth pockets such as mobility, electronics, consumer brands, healthcare, and packaging. Purchasing decisions weigh supply assurance, regulatory compliance, and cost-in-use alongside performance. Leading suppliers pursue multi-year agreements, regional capacity debottlenecking, and logistics optimization to support reliable service levels across these industries.
AutomotiveAutomotive customers seek low-VOC, heat-resistant tackifiers for interior assemblies, NVH solutions, and component bonding. With evolving cabin air-quality norms and lightweighting targets, qualification programs prioritize odor, fogging, and thermal stability. Partnerships with Tier-1s and adhesive formulators enable co-engineered solutions that fit high-throughput production.
Electrical & ElectronicsElectronics demand centers on assembly adhesives, encapsulants, and coatings where cleanliness, low outgassing, and adhesion to mixed substrates are crucial. Suppliers differentiate through tight specifications, clean packaging, and rapid technical support. Growth aligns with device miniaturization and the expansion of consumer and industrial electronics manufacturing hubs.
Consumer ProductsIn consumer goods, C9 resins enhance pressure-sensitive labels, footwear bonding, and general-purpose hot-melts for packaging and household items. Brand owners value consistent appearance and reliable bond performance across climate conditions. Producers cultivate converter relationships, offering processability and color-stability that reduce waste and improve throughput.
HealthcareHealthcare applications emphasize compliance, documentation, and stable performance for device assembly and medical disposables. Vendors support audit readiness and change-control transparency, helping accelerate onboarding in regulated settings. Product development focuses on low odor, predictable rheology, and compatibility with sterilization where applicable.
PackagingPackaging represents a significant outlet for hot-melt adhesives where line speed, fiber tear, and cold/heat resistance drive resin choice. Converters seek cost-in-use advantages and dependable supply to minimize downtime. Suppliers invest in regional warehousing and formulation support to meet seasonal peaks and new substrate trends.

-
Competition from Alternative Resin Technologies: One of the key restraints for the Global C9 Resin Market is the increasing competition from alternative resin technologies. As industries strive for improved performance, sustainability, and cost-effectiveness, various alternatives to C9 resins, such as C5 resins, hydrocarbon resins, and bio-based resins, have gained popularity. These alternative resins offer comparable or even superior properties in certain applications, making them attractive choices for manufacturers looking to reduce costs or enhance product characteristics. As a result, C9 resins face significant competition, particularly in applications where other resins may offer better processing ease, lower costs, or improved sustainability credentials.
The growing emphasis on eco-friendly and sustainable solutions is driving the development of alternative resin technologies that are perceived as more environmentally responsible. For example, bio-based resins derived from renewable resources are becoming a more favorable option due to their reduced environmental impact compared to petroleum-based resins. As consumers and regulators increasingly demand more sustainable products, manufacturers are under pressure to adopt alternative resins that meet these expectations. This shift in consumer preference towards renewable and green alternatives can hinder the growth of the C9 resin market, particularly in industries such as packaging and automotive, where sustainability is a high priority.
Another factor contributing to the competition from alternative resins is the technological advancements in other resin formulations. For instance, epoxy resins, polyurethane resins, and silicone-based resins are being developed with improved properties such as enhanced heat resistance, mechanical strength, and chemical stability, which can compete with C9 resins in certain industrial applications. These alternatives are increasingly being used in the automotive, construction, and electronics industries, which can limit the market share for C9 resins. The continued innovation in alternative resin technologies poses a significant challenge to the C9 resin market, requiring manufacturers to invest in research and development to improve the performance and sustainability of C9 resins to remain competitive.
